The City View: US and UK rate hikes imminent

Today Andy Silvester talks to City PM’s Economics and Markets reporter Jack Barnett. They go through UK and US rate rises, discuss the likelihood of a recession, and explain equity market slumps.

Also in the news: Crossrail is only 20 days away and sales are slowing at JD Wetherspoon.
